Abstract

Several factors are responsible for signal corruption but the most common factors are attenuation distortions, delay distortion and noise. Noise is a major limiting factor in communication system performance and they are caused by several means over various channel. In this research, a model was developed by the use of an application in MATLAB called simulink to simulate the effect of distortion on signals and adaptive filtered was also modeled to filter the noise that constitute the distortion. It was found out that by the use of an adaptive filter noise cancellation could be effected. The results are graphically displayed by the various graphs of the input signal, signal with noise and the filtered output.
